path模块
path.join([...path])
// 方法 可以有多个参数,或者没有参数
// 将 方法的 参数 拼接成 路径片段
path.resolve([...path])
// 解析 路径参数 解析成 绝对路径
注意:
/写在路径前面代表 根目录
有服务器(软件):
/根目录就是服务器监听目录
没有服务器:
当前文件所在的盘
const** path = require('path')
// 单纯将路径片段拼接
console.log(path.resolve('/a','/b','c'))
// path.resolve 解析 路径参数,解析成绝对路径
nodejs 内置的全局变量
__dirname
当前文件所在目录的绝对路径
path.join(__dirname,'../fs')
__filename
当前文件所在的绝对路径
const path = require('path')
console.log(__dirname)
//E:\三\day\全局变量
console.log(__filename)
//E:\三\day\全局变量\index.js
console.log(path.join(__dirname,'../demo'))
//E:\三\day\demo